    libvmmapi: Add a subdirectory for amd64-specific code
    
    Move vmmapi_freebsd.c there.  It contains x86-specific code used only by
    bhyveload(8).
    
    Move vcpu_reset() into vmmapi_machdep.c.  It is also x86-specific.
    
    No functional change intended.

+/*
+ * From Intel Vol 3a:
+ * Table 9-1. IA-32 Processor States Following Power-up, Reset or INIT
+ */
+int
+vcpu_reset(struct vcpu *vcpu)
+{
+       int error;
+       uint64_t rflags, rip, cr0, cr4, zero, desc_base, rdx;
+       uint32_t desc_access, desc_limit;
+       uint16_t sel;
+
+       zero = 0;
+
+       rflags = 0x2;
+       error = vm_set_register(vcpu, VM_REG_GUEST_RFLAGS, rflags);
+       if (error)
+               goto done;
+
+       rip = 0xfff0;
+       if ((error = vm_set_register(vcpu, VM_REG_GUEST_RIP, rip)) != 0)
+               goto done;
+
+       /*
+        * According to Intels Software Developer Manual CR0 should be
+        * initialized with CR0_ET | CR0_NW | CR0_CD but that crashes some
+        * guests like Windows.
+        */
+       cr0 = CR0_NE;
+       if ((error = vm_set_register(vcpu, VM_REG_GUEST_CR0, cr0)) != 0)
+               goto done;
+
+       if ((error = vm_set_register(vcpu, VM_REG_GUEST_CR2, zero)) != 0)
+               goto done;
+
+       if ((error = vm_set_register(vcpu, VM_REG_GUEST_CR3, zero)) != 0)
+               goto done;
+
+       cr4 = 0;
+       if ((error = vm_set_register(vcpu, VM_REG_GUEST_CR4, cr4)) != 0)
+               goto done;
+
+       /*
+        * CS: present, r/w, accessed, 16-bit, byte granularity, usable
+        */
+       desc_base = 0xffff0000;
+       desc_limit = 0xffff;
+       desc_access = 0x0093;
+       error = vm_set_desc(vcpu, VM_REG_GUEST_CS,
+                           desc_base, desc_limit, desc_access);
+       if (error)
+               goto done;
+
+       sel = 0xf000;
+       if ((error = vm_set_register(vcpu, VM_REG_GUEST_CS, sel)) != 0)
+               goto done;
+
+       /*
+        * SS,DS,ES,FS,GS: present, r/w, accessed, 16-bit, byte granularity
+        */
+       desc_base = 0;
+       desc_limit = 0xffff;
+       desc_access = 0x0093;
+       error = vm_set_desc(vcpu, VM_REG_GUEST_SS,
+                           desc_base, desc_limit, desc_access);
+       if (error)
+               goto done;
+
+       error = vm_set_desc(vcpu, VM_REG_GUEST_DS,
+                           desc_base, desc_limit, desc_access);
+       if (error)
+               goto done;
+
+       error = vm_set_desc(vcpu, VM_REG_GUEST_ES,
+                           desc_base, desc_limit, desc_access);
+       if (error)
+               goto done;
+
+       error = vm_set_desc(vcpu, VM_REG_GUEST_FS,
+                           desc_base, desc_limit, desc_access);
+       if (error)
+               goto done;
+
+       error = vm_set_desc(vcpu, VM_REG_GUEST_GS,
+                           desc_base, desc_limit, desc_access);
+       if (error)
+               goto done;
+
+       sel = 0;
+       if ((error = vm_set_register(vcpu, VM_REG_GUEST_SS, sel)) != 0)
+               goto done;
+       if ((error = vm_set_register(vcpu, VM_REG_GUEST_DS, sel)) != 0)
+               goto done;
+       if ((error = vm_set_register(vcpu, VM_REG_GUEST_ES, sel)) != 0)
+               goto done;
+       if ((error = vm_set_register(vcpu, VM_REG_GUEST_FS, sel)) != 0)
+               goto done;
+       if ((error = vm_set_register(vcpu, VM_REG_GUEST_GS, sel)) != 0)
+               goto done;
+
+       if ((error = vm_set_register(vcpu, VM_REG_GUEST_EFER, zero)) != 0)
+               goto done;
+
+       /* General purpose registers */
+       rdx = 0xf00;
+       if ((error = vm_set_register(vcpu, VM_REG_GUEST_RAX, zero)) != 0)
+               goto done;
+       if ((error = vm_set_register(vcpu, VM_REG_GUEST_RBX, zero)) != 0)
+               goto done;
+       if ((error = vm_set_register(vcpu, VM_REG_GUEST_RCX, zero)) != 0)
+               goto done;
+       if ((error = vm_set_register(vcpu, VM_REG_GUEST_RDX, rdx)) != 0)
+               goto done;
+       if ((error = vm_set_register(vcpu, VM_REG_GUEST_RSI, zero)) != 0)
+               goto done;
+       if ((error = vm_set_register(vcpu, VM_REG_GUEST_RDI, zero)) != 0)
+               goto done;
+       if ((error = vm_set_register(vcpu, VM_REG_GUEST_RBP, zero)) != 0)
+               goto done;
+       if ((error = vm_set_register(vcpu, VM_REG_GUEST_RSP, zero)) != 0)
+               goto done;
+       if ((error = vm_set_register(vcpu, VM_REG_GUEST_R8, zero)) != 0)
+               goto done;
+       if ((error = vm_set_register(vcpu, VM_REG_GUEST_R9, zero)) != 0)
+               goto done;
+       if ((error = vm_set_register(vcpu, VM_REG_GUEST_R10, zero)) != 0)
+               goto done;
+       if ((error = vm_set_register(vcpu, VM_REG_GUEST_R11, zero)) != 0)
+               goto done;
+       if ((error = vm_set_register(vcpu, VM_REG_GUEST_R12, zero)) != 0)
+               goto done;
+       if ((error = vm_set_register(vcpu, VM_REG_GUEST_R13, zero)) != 0)
+               goto done;
+       if ((error = vm_set_register(vcpu, VM_REG_GUEST_R14, zero)) != 0)
+               goto done;
+       if ((error = vm_set_register(vcpu, VM_REG_GUEST_R15, zero)) != 0)
+               goto done;
+
+       /* GDTR, IDTR */
+       desc_base = 0;
+       desc_limit = 0xffff;
+       desc_access = 0;
+       error = vm_set_desc(vcpu, VM_REG_GUEST_GDTR,
+                           desc_base, desc_limit, desc_access);
+       if (error != 0)
+               goto done;
+
+       error = vm_set_desc(vcpu, VM_REG_GUEST_IDTR,
+                           desc_base, desc_limit, desc_access);
+       if (error != 0)
+               goto done;
+
+       /* TR */
+       desc_base = 0;
+       desc_limit = 0xffff;
+       desc_access = 0x0000008b;
+       error = vm_set_desc(vcpu, VM_REG_GUEST_TR, 0, 0, desc_access);
+       if (error)
+               goto done;
+
+       sel = 0;
+       if ((error = vm_set_register(vcpu, VM_REG_GUEST_TR, sel)) != 0)
+               goto done;
+
+       /* LDTR */
+       desc_base = 0;
+       desc_limit = 0xffff;
+       desc_access = 0x00000082;
+       error = vm_set_desc(vcpu, VM_REG_GUEST_LDTR, desc_base,
+                           desc_limit, desc_access);
+       if (error)
+               goto done;
+
+       sel = 0;
+       if ((error = vm_set_register(vcpu, VM_REG_GUEST_LDTR, 0)) != 0)
+               goto done;
+
+       if ((error = vm_set_register(vcpu, VM_REG_GUEST_DR6,
+                0xffff0ff0)) != 0)
+               goto done;
+       if ((error = vm_set_register(vcpu, VM_REG_GUEST_DR7, 0x400)) !=
+           0)
+               goto done;
+
+       if ((error = vm_set_register(vcpu, VM_REG_GUEST_INTR_SHADOW,
+                zero)) != 0)
+               goto done;
+
+       error = 0;
+done:
+       return (error);
+}
